Senior Scrum Master

As a Senior Scrum Master, you will play a pivotal role in driving the team towards enhanced efficiency and quality, fostering an environment that encourages innovation and deep team engagement. Your leadership will cultivate a learning culture where continuous improvement thrives, and the team embraces the willingness to adapt and change. Through your guidance, you will empower teams to operate at their best, facilitating collaboration, driving agile principles, and ensuring that the team consistently delivers exceptional value. 

Responsibilities

  • Facilitate successful Agile implementations, ensuring that SAFe and Scrum principles and practices are effectively applied. 
  • Foster a collaborative and self-organizing team environment, enabling high-performance and efficient delivery of team goals. 
  • Coach and mentor team members and stakeholders on Agile practices, fostering a culture of continuous improvement and learning. 
  • Facilitate scrum events “Sprint planning, Daily standups, Sprint reviews... etc) and promote team collaboration. 
  • Resolve conflicts and impediments that may hinder the team's progress, promoting effective communication and collaboration. 
  • Promote transparency and alignment between the development team and product stakeholders, ensuring a shared understanding of priorities. 
  • Drive the adoption and implementation of Agile metrics and reporting, providing valuable insights to guide decision-making and improve team performance. 
  • Continuously identify opportunities for process improvements, implement changes, and measure the impact of those changes on team productivity and project outcomes. 
  • Effective vendor engagement with the right people. 
  • From Idea to Delivery, the Scrum Master is focused on bringing the best of themselves to help their team have the most effective and efficient workflow. 
  • Min of 4 years as a Senior Scrum Master/Agile Practitioner with a proven record of leading successful agile teams. 
  • Bachelor’s degree in a related field; Certified ScrumMaster CSM, SAFe or equivalent certification is preferred. 
  • Strong understanding of the Scrum framework and agile methodologies. 
  • Synchronize with product managers to ensure a well-prioritized backlog. 
  • Shield the team from distractions and interruptions that hinder the team's progress. 
  • Demonstrated experience in coaching and mentoring teams to enhance performance and adopt agile practices. 
  • Ensuring coordination and alignment across multiple teams within the ART. 
  • Leading effective retrospectives to identify areas for improvement. 
  • High emotional intelligence with the ability to adapt communication styles accordingly. 
  • Focus on fostering a people-centric approach while maintaining process integrity. 
  • Proven skills in change management, including the ability to overcome resistance to change and highlight future benefits to the team. 
  • Monitor, Track and Report regularly on team health and team maturity. 
  • Empowering the team to make decisions and take ownership of their work. 
  • Building relationships with product managers, architects, and other stakeholders. 
  • Identifying potential risks that could impact the delivery and recommend strategies to mitigate those risks 
  • Familiarity with agile tools and techniques (e.g., ADO, Jira, miro) to support project tracking and team collaboration.

Common Interview Questions for Senior Scrum Master
Can you describe your experience leading Agile teams as a Senior Scrum Master?

When answering this question, discuss specific projects where you implemented Agile methodologies, the challenges faced, and the outcomes achieved. Highlight your role in promoting collaboration and how you empowered teams to own their work.
